    An archipelago (pronounced /?rk?'p?l?go?/) is a chain or cluster of islands that is formed tectonically. The word archipelago literally means "chief sea", from Italian arcipelago (art?i'pelago), derived ultimately from Greek arkhon (arkhi-) ("leader") and pelagos ("sea"). In Italian, possibly following a tradition of antiquity, the Archipelago (Greek: ????p??a???) was the proper name for the Aegean Sea and, later, usage shifted to refer to the Aegean Islands (since the sea is remarkable for its large number of islands). It is now used to generally refer to any island group or, sometimes, to a sea containing a large number of scattered islands like the Aegean Sea.
